
要在Excel表格中进行搜索,可以使用多种方法,包括“查找功能”、“筛选功能”、“条件格式化”、“VLOOKUP函数”等。其中,最常用的方法是“查找功能”,因为它简单快捷。下面将详细介绍如何使用这些方法来提高搜索效率。
一、查找功能
查找功能是Excel中最基本也是最常用的搜索工具。它可以帮助你快速找到需要的信息。
1.1 使用查找功能
要使用查找功能,请按照以下步骤进行:
- 打开Excel文件:确保你已经打开需要搜索的Excel文件。
- 按下快捷键 Ctrl + F:这将打开“查找和替换”对话框。
- 输入搜索关键词:在“查找内容”框中输入你要查找的内容。
- 点击“查找下一个”:Excel将会在当前工作表中查找并高亮显示匹配的单元格。
1.2 高级查找选项
Excel的查找功能不仅限于简单的文字匹配,还提供了高级选项:
- 区分大小写:如果你需要区分大小写,可以勾选“区分大小写”选项。
- 匹配整个单元格内容:如果你需要精确匹配整个单元格内容,可以勾选“匹配整个单元格内容”选项。
- 查找范围:你可以选择在整个工作簿或者当前工作表中查找。
二、筛选功能
筛选功能可以帮助你根据特定条件筛选数据,以便更快找到你需要的信息。
2.1 使用筛选功能
要使用筛选功能,请按照以下步骤进行:
- 选择数据区域:选择你想要筛选的数据区域。
- 点击“数据”选项卡:在Excel顶部菜单栏中点击“数据”选项卡。
- 点击“筛选”按钮:在“数据”选项卡中点击“筛选”按钮。
- 设置筛选条件:在每个列标题下会出现一个下拉箭头,点击箭头并设置筛选条件。例如,你可以选择特定的值、文本包含特定字符或者数字范围。
2.2 多重筛选
你可以对多个列同时进行筛选,以进一步缩小搜索范围:
- 设置多个条件:在每个需要筛选的列中设置筛选条件。
- 组合条件:Excel将会根据所有设置的条件进行筛选,显示满足所有条件的行。
三、条件格式化
条件格式化可以帮助你突出显示满足特定条件的单元格,从而更容易找到所需信息。
3.1 使用条件格式化
要使用条件格式化,请按照以下步骤进行:
- 选择数据区域:选择你想要应用条件格式化的数据区域。
- 点击“开始”选项卡:在Excel顶部菜单栏中点击“开始”选项卡。
- 点击“条件格式”按钮:在“开始”选项卡中点击“条件格式”按钮。
- 选择规则类型:从下拉菜单中选择你需要的规则类型。例如,你可以选择“突出显示单元格规则”中的“文本包含”。
- 设置条件和格式:输入条件并设置格式,例如字体颜色、背景颜色等。
3.2 自定义条件格式
你还可以创建自定义条件格式,以满足更复杂的需求:
- 使用公式:在“条件格式”菜单中选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。
- 输入公式:输入一个公式来定义条件。例如,输入
=A1>100来突出显示大于100的单元格。 - 设置格式:设置满足条件时的格式。
四、VLOOKUP函数
VLOOKUP函数是一种强大的工具,可以帮助你在大数据集中快速查找信息。
4.1 使用VLOOKUP函数
要使用VLOOKUP函数,请按照以下步骤进行:
- 选择目标单元格:选择你想要显示查找结果的单元格。
- 输入公式:在目标单元格中输入
=V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])。 - 设置参数:
- lookup_value:要查找的值。
- table_array:包含数据的表格区域。
- col_index_num:要返回值的列号。
- range_lookup:可选参数,TRUE表示近似匹配,FALSE表示精确匹配。
4.2 示例
假设你有一个包含产品信息的表格,你想要查找某个产品的价格:
- lookup_value:输入产品名称,例如“苹果”。
- table_array:选择包含产品信息的表格区域,例如A1:B10。
- col_index_num:输入价格所在的列号,例如2。
- range_lookup:输入FALSE以进行精确匹配。
最终公式应为:=VLOOKUP("苹果", A1:B10, 2, FALSE)。
五、INDEX和MATCH函数组合
INDEX和MATCH函数的组合可以提供比VLOOKUP更灵活的搜索功能。
5.1 使用INDEX和MATCH函数
要使用INDEX和MATCH函数组合,请按照以下步骤进行:
- 选择目标单元格:选择你想要显示查找结果的单元格。
- 输入公式:在目标单元格中输入
=INDEX(array, MATCH(lookup_value, lookup_array, [match_type]))。
5.2 设置参数
- array:要返回值的数组。
- lookup_value:要查找的值。
- lookup_array:包含查找值的数组。
- match_type:可选参数,0表示精确匹配,1表示小于或等于,-1表示大于或等于。
5.3 示例
假设你有一个包含员工信息的表格,你想要查找某个员工的部门:
- array:选择包含部门信息的列,例如B1:B10。
- lookup_value:输入员工姓名,例如“张三”。
- lookup_array:选择包含员工姓名的列,例如A1:A10。
- match_type:输入0以进行精确匹配。
最终公式应为:=INDEX(B1:B10, MATCH("张三", A1:A10, 0))。
六、使用宏进行高级搜索
如果你经常需要进行复杂的搜索,可以考虑使用宏来自动化这个过程。
6.1 录制宏
要录制一个宏,请按照以下步骤进行:
- 点击“开发工具”选项卡:在Excel顶部菜单栏中点击“开发工具”选项卡。如果没有看到“开发工具”选项卡,可以在“文件”菜单中的“选项”中启用。
- 点击“录制宏”按钮:在“开发工具”选项卡中点击“录制宏”按钮。
- 执行搜索操作:在录制过程中执行你想要自动化的搜索操作。
- 停止录制宏:完成操作后,点击“停止录制”按钮。
6.2 运行宏
要运行录制的宏,请按照以下步骤进行:
- 点击“开发工具”选项卡:在Excel顶部菜单栏中点击“开发工具”选项卡。
- 点击“宏”按钮:在“开发工具”选项卡中点击“宏”按钮。
- 选择宏并运行:选择你录制的宏并点击“运行”。
七、使用Power Query进行高级数据搜索
Power Query是一种强大的数据处理工具,可以帮助你进行高级数据搜索和分析。
7.1 导入数据
要使用Power Query导入数据,请按照以下步骤进行:
- 点击“数据”选项卡:在Excel顶部菜单栏中点击“数据”选项卡。
- 点击“获取数据”按钮:在“数据”选项卡中点击“获取数据”按钮。
- 选择数据源:选择你需要导入的数据源,例如Excel文件、数据库等。
7.2 使用查询编辑器
导入数据后,你可以使用查询编辑器进行数据处理和搜索:
- 筛选数据:使用查询编辑器中的筛选功能筛选数据。
- 应用条件:应用条件格式化以突出显示满足条件的行。
- 添加计算列:添加计算列以进行复杂的数据分析。
八、使用Excel在线搜索功能
Excel还提供了在线搜索功能,可以帮助你在网络上查找相关信息。
8.1 使用智能查询
要使用智能查询,请按照以下步骤进行:
- 选择数据区域:选择你想要搜索的数据区域。
- 点击“开始”选项卡:在Excel顶部菜单栏中点击“开始”选项卡。
- 点击“智能查询”按钮:在“开始”选项卡中点击“智能查询”按钮。
- 查看结果:Excel将会在侧边栏显示相关的搜索结果。
8.2 使用Bing搜索
你还可以使用Excel集成的Bing搜索功能:
- 选择数据:选择你想要搜索的数据。
- 右键点击:右键点击选择的数据区域。
- 选择“智能查找”:从右键菜单中选择“智能查找”。
- 查看结果:在侧边栏中查看Bing搜索结果。
九、使用插件和第三方工具
除了Excel自身的功能外,还有许多插件和第三方工具可以帮助你进行高级搜索。
9.1 安装插件
要安装插件,请按照以下步骤进行:
- 点击“插入”选项卡:在Excel顶部菜单栏中点击“插入”选项卡。
- 点击“获取加载项”按钮:在“插入”选项卡中点击“获取加载项”按钮。
- 搜索并安装插件:在加载项商店中搜索并安装你需要的插件。
9.2 使用第三方工具
许多第三方工具提供了更强大的数据搜索和分析功能:
- 数据分析工具:例如Tableau、Power BI等可以帮助你进行高级数据分析和可视化。
- 数据清洗工具:例如OpenRefine可以帮助你进行数据清洗和整理。
十、最佳实践和常见问题
在使用Excel进行搜索时,遵循一些最佳实践可以提高你的效率。
10.1 最佳实践
- 使用命名范围:使用命名范围可以使公式更易读。
- 定期备份数据:定期备份你的数据以防止数据丢失。
- 使用模板:使用搜索模板可以减少重复工作。
10.2 常见问题
- 查找功能不工作:检查你是否在正确的工作表中查找,并确保查找范围正确。
- 筛选结果不准确:检查筛选条件是否设置正确,并确保数据格式一致。
- VLOOKUP返回错误:检查lookup_value是否存在,并确保table_array和col_index_num正确。
通过本文的介绍,你应该已经掌握了如何在Excel表格中进行搜索的多种方法。无论是简单的查找功能,还是复杂的条件格式化和函数组合,这些方法都可以帮助你提高工作效率。希望这些技巧能对你有所帮助。
相关问答FAQs:
1. 如何在Excel表格中进行搜索?
- 在Excel中,您可以使用“查找和替换”功能来搜索表格中的特定内容。在主菜单中选择“编辑”,然后点击“查找”或使用快捷键Ctrl + F打开查找对话框。在对话框中输入您要搜索的内容,然后点击“查找下一个”按钮进行搜索。
2. 如何在Excel表格中进行高级搜索?
- 如果您需要更复杂的搜索操作,可以使用Excel的“高级筛选”功能。在主菜单中选择“数据”,然后点击“高级”,打开高级筛选对话框。在对话框中选择要搜索的数据范围和搜索条件,然后点击“确定”进行高级搜索。
3. 如何在Excel表格中进行条件筛选?
- 如果您只想筛选并显示符合特定条件的数据,可以使用Excel的“自动筛选”功能。在要筛选的数据列上点击筛选图标,然后选择“自定义筛选”或其他条件筛选选项。在对话框中设置所需的条件,然后点击“确定”进行筛选。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4560506